How much does it cost to rent a home in Surfside?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Surfside 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,174 | $2,100 | $10,000+ |
| Surfside 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$10,878 | $2,300 | $10,000+ |
| Surfside 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$18,452 | $5,500 | $10,000+ |
| Surfside 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$29,081 | $9,500 | $10,000+ |
| Surfside 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$42,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Surfside
What type of rentals are currently available in Surfside?
There are currently 975 Apartments for Rent in Surfside,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,450 to $48,000. There are also 409 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Surfside ranging from $1,500 to $70,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Surfside?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Surfside ranges from $1,500 to $70,000 with an average monthly rent of $15,919.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Surfside?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Surfside range from $2,300 to $48,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,300 to $70,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$5,500 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$10,000.
